Hyderabad: A passenger allegedly assaulted a Lufthansa cabin crew member during an international flight from Frankfurt to Hyderabad, leading to a police case at RGIA police station on Tuesday.
According to police, the incident occurred aboard Lufthansa flight LH-752 while cabin crew member Peter Bauser, a German national who has been working with the airline for the past six years, was performing routine duties. During the flight, a service trolley reportedly brushed against the leg of passenger B Satish Kumar by accident.
Despite the crew member immediately apologising for the incident, the passenger allegedly became agitated and physically attacked the cabin crew member. The crew member suffered injuries in the incident.
Following the aircraft’s arrival in Hyderabad, the injured crew member lodged a complaint with the RGIA police.
Based on the complaint, a case has been registered and being investigated.
